Output ef225a6d0f11931b93e77646207c114b0c7447429e1449cb1437ed8413295102:2

value
20960000
script pubkey
OP_0 OP_PUSHBYTES_20 866e2c3c557af4f3b7fe7b82735d6335be7c78e4
address
bc1qsehzc0z40t608dl70wp8xhtrxkl8c78yahwz03
transaction
ef225a6d0f11931b93e77646207c114b0c7447429e1449cb1437ed8413295102
spent
true